Our pelvic health team manages conditions specific to pregnancy, post-natal and menopause; painful sexual intercourse; as well as to provide pre and post-op pelvic floor rehab for gynaecological surgeries. We also manage bladder and bowel problems, pelvic pain and lumbo-pelvic pain for both males and females.
Our Pelvic Health case load is diverse, with referrals from a variety of Doctors and Specialists. We have state of the art equipment for our pelvic health team; real -time and therapeutic ultrasound as well as laser therapy machines. Essential Requirements
● Exceptional communication skills and the ability to work cohesively with co-workers and other health care professionals as well as the ability to build client relationships.
● Bachelor of Physiotherapy
● Either completion or in process of completing post graduate studies in Pelvic Health.
● AHPRA Registration
● National Police Clearance certificate
● Professional indemnity insurance, current first aid/CPR training & working with children check
